Residential care homes in Apple Valley may appeal to seniors who value smaller, more close-knit communities and many opportunities for socialization. Apple Valley care homes typically take in fewer residents, meaning older adults know each resident in the home and develop strong friendships.

Older-adult care homes vary more than other options for senior living in Apple Valley, so families can choose from a wide range of prices, amenities, and services. Transportation

Apple Valley is a somewhat car-dependent city. The city manages four bus routes and a paratransit service, on which seniors, veterans, and those with disabilities may be eligible for fare discounts. Additionally, rideshare services like Lyft and Uber are available in Apple Valley.

Health care

Apple Valley offers several health care providers for seniors wanting to be proactive about their health or for seniors seeking treatment for chronic conditions. The top hospitals that service Apple Valley include the Saint Mary Medical Center and Victor Valley Global Medical Center.

Senior activities

Located on the edge of the Mojave Desert, Apple Valley offers seniors both warmth and beauty. In fact, the city is so picturesque that it’s been a major filming location for dozens of movies and commercials. Ranches, hiking trails, golf courses, and hot springs await seniors who appreciate an active lifestyle and natural landscapes. The top cultural and historical attractions in Apple Valley include the Victor Valley Museum and the Apple Valley Legacy Museum. There are a number of popular outdoor attractions in Apple Valley, and local favorites include Deep Creek Hot Springs, Oak Springs Ranch, and Apple Valley Golf Course.

What are care homes?

Residential care homes are houses in residential neighborhoods that are equipped, adapted, and staffed to care for a small number of residents, usually between two and 10. Like assisted living communities, staff at care homes typically help residents with activities of daily living, including bathing, dressing, and medication management. Although residential care homes vary significantly depending on the community, services usually include:

  • Help with personal care
  • Medication management
  • Mobility assistance
  • Nutritious meals
  • Social activities and outings
  • Housekeeping
  • Laundry

Care Homes

A care home offers a communal environment for seniors who are capable of performing the activities of daily living with minimal assistance but want supervision within a safe and secure location. Services provided might include food service, washing clothes, and transportation. This type of community is akin to a single-family home. In California, the annual median cost for an assisted living community is around $54,000. The state of California has specific standards associated with this type of community. The Department of Social Services and Community Care Licensing Division governs this community type.

Demographics and Values

In Apple Valley, 11.4% of the citizens are veterans of the United States military. The current population of Apple Valley consists of 73,077 people. Apple Valley has a population density of 376 people per square mile. Based on gender, 51.8% are female and 48.2% are male. The median age of Apple Valley is 37 years old. Of the population of Apple Valley 30.7% have a high-school diploma, 6.6% have a graduate degree, and 16.6% have a college degree. Demographically, Apple Valley is 80.3% white, 0.0% Pacific Islander or Native Hawaiian, 3.4% Asian, 3.0% other or not specified, 0.7% Native American, 4.7% mixed race, 35.1% Hispanic, and 7.9% black. Out of the total population of Apple Valley, 16.0% have some form of disability, 5.7% are widows, 18.1% live in poverty, and 6.6% do not have health insurance.
